Output 69b455258205bae5eddebe5ffeee46428a0af78d367f936b7ebdc2a865d23ae4:6

value
20898709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ec41e2dca39c38e9e286f4fa66a0cd9334f1245 OP_EQUAL
address
38sVa1taQZnaoh79Y4vnxRGdzFoEiDmDLx
transaction
69b455258205bae5eddebe5ffeee46428a0af78d367f936b7ebdc2a865d23ae4
spent
true